J'ai déplacé un site de WordPress vers Magento. Mais maintenant, le webmaster de Google n'indexe pas le site. J'ai envoyé le plan du site, mais il reste en attente. J'ai aussi un fichier robots.txt
qui a le contenu suivant
User-agent: *
Allow: /
sitemap: http://www.example.com/sitemap.xml
Dois-je faire quelque chose après avoir quitté WordPress vers Magento?
Modifier :
Je pense que le problème vient de robots.txt car, dans la page des erreurs d'analyse de la console de recherche Google, le fichier robots.txt affiche un statut orange au lieu d'une coche verte. Sous cet onglet, un message s'affiche: "Google n'a pas pu analyser votre site, car nous n'avons pas pu accéder au fichier robots.txt de votre site". Mais lorsque je vais sur mydomain.com/robots.txt, mon fichier robots.txt est affiché.
, J'ai essayé Fetch en tant que Google dans la console de recherche. Il récupère complètement lorsque j'utilise 'fetch' et partiellement lorsque j'utilise 'fetch and render'.
Comme W3dk le dit dans les commentaires, un fichier robots.txt plus correct serait:
User-agent: *
Disallow:
sitemap: http://www.example.com/sitemap.xml
Mais votre plus gros problème est probablement que vous n’avez pas redirigé vos anciennes URL vers vos nouvelles. Vous dites:
Il y a un léger changement dans la structure des URL sur mon site Web, mais je n'ai pas de problème si l'ancienne URL indique "page non trouvée".
Google va immédiatement indexer les pages si vous redirigez les anciennes URL vers les nouvelles. Faire ce type de changement sans redirections tue votre profil de lien entrant et la confiance de Google dans votre site. Cela peut prendre des mois, voire des années pour que votre site soit indexé et bénéficie d'un classement aussi bon qu'avant. Implémenter les redirections.